How to Enable a VPN On Your Ipad
It seems a very long time past now, but when the web was in it's infancy it really was much more open. You'd rarely get blocked or filtered or redirected when trying to access a website. It was genuinely identical, meaning that a man in one country would have exactly the same access to anyone else.
Unfortunately those days have gone and the net experience you have is very much dependant on your location. Web sites will normally block access to folks in specific states, or route them to different locations.
